Nostalgia: A Walk Down Memory Lane

Homecomings are often steeped in nostalgia. The familiar scents, sounds, and sights evoke memories of the past. Here are some expressions that evoke nostalgia:

  • A Walk Down Memory Lane: A journey through the past, revisiting cherished memories.
  • Tales of Yore: Stories from the past, often with a touch of humor.
  • The Good Old Days: A nostalgic look back at a time when life seemed simpler and more carefree.
